Oil & Gas Storage: From Shore Tanks to Modern Solutions
The industry of oil and gas storage has evolved dramatically over the decades. Early methods relied on substantial shore tanks, which while durable, presented challenges related to volume and environmental impact. Modern solutions offer improved efficiency and sustainability.
From underground caverns to floating platforms, the industry is regularly advancing new technologies. These advancements tackle concerns related to safety, optimization, and environmental stewardship.
- Additionally, the utilization of smart technologies, such as sensors, allows for real-time analysis of storage levels and potential threats.
